Quiz: Do You Know Canada’s North?

Do you know Canada? There are so many strange things that people believe about Canada. I remember when I was studying in Texas, my university buddies thought everyone lived in an igloo and was always shivering in an icy cold country. Truth is, most Canadians live in the southern part of Canada, where there is summer, where it’s wonderfully hot for about three months, and it can even get swelteringly hot for about two weeks.

But even most Canadians themselves do not know much about Canada’s North.

So, whether you’re Canadian or not, take this quiz about Canada’s North, and find out if you can separate fact from fake (we don’t say “fiction” anymore). Maybe, you can even earn yourself an UHCC (Unofficial Honorary Canadian Citizenship).
